Why Automatic Voltage Regulator for Generator Is Necessary

I have found that an Automatic Voltage Regulator (AVR) is essential for keeping a generator’s output stable. When the load changes, the voltage can rise or drop quickly, and the AVR automatically adjusts the generator’s excitation to maintain a steady voltage. This means my appliances, tools, and sensitive equipment get the consistent power they need without sudden fluctuations.

From my experience, this is especially important because unstable voltage can damage electronics, reduce motor performance, and even cause overheating in connected devices. With an AVR, I feel more confident that my generator is protecting my equipment instead of putting it at risk. It also helps improve overall efficiency by making the generator respond smoothly to changing power demands.

I also see the AVR as a key part of generator reliability. It reduces the need for constant manual adjustment, saves time, and helps the generator perform better in both light and heavy load conditions. In short, I consider an AVR necessary because it keeps power safe, steady, and dependable.

My Buying Guides on Automatic Voltage Regulator For Generator

What I Look for First

When I shop for an automatic voltage regulator for a generator, my first priority is compatibility. I always check whether the AVR matches my generator’s brand, model, phase, and power rating. If I get this wrong, the regulator may not work properly or could even damage the generator. I also look at the voltage range and frequency requirements to make sure the unit can handle my setup.

Why the Right AVR Matters to Me

I’ve learned that the AVR is one of the most important parts of a generator because it keeps the output voltage stable. Without a good AVR, I could face flickering lights, damaged appliances, or inconsistent generator performance. For me, a reliable AVR means smoother operation and better protection for everything connected to the generator.

Key Features I Check

When I compare options, I pay attention to a few features:

  • Voltage regulation accuracy
  • Build quality and heat resistance
  • Protection against overload and short circuits
  • Easy installation and wiring
  • Compatibility with gasoline, diesel, or standby generators

I prefer an AVR that feels durable and is designed for long-term use, especially if I plan to run the generator often.

How I Choose the Right Size

I always make sure the AVR is rated for the generator’s output capacity. If the AVR is too small, it may fail under load. If it’s too large or not designed for my generator type, it may not regulate properly. I usually check the generator’s wattage, output voltage, and current rating before I buy anything.

My Thoughts on Build Quality

In my experience, build quality makes a big difference. I look for regulators with solid casing, good insulation, and components that can withstand vibration and heat. Since generators often run in tough conditions, I want an AVR that can last without frequent replacement.

Installation and Maintenance

I prefer an AVR that is easy to install, especially if I’m replacing an old one. Clear wiring instructions, proper terminals, and a user manual are important to me. After installation, I also make it a habit to inspect the connections regularly and keep the generator clean to help the AVR perform well.
